I run my Mobius at 1280 x 720 30fps and get about 10 hrs on a 32 GB card. I'm not sure if this setting is available on the A118 and if it is how the vid compares to higher res. On a trip I need to be able to record about 8 - 10 hrs per day without looping - so might need a 64. I copy the card contents to a HDD at end of each day and wipe the card ready for next day. For normal use I just set it to loop and let it do its thing - so a 16 or 32 is sufficient.
